[This review was collected as part of a promotion.] I upgraded to this phone from an S23 Ultra and, while I don't regret it, there's nothing that really stands out to me as a huge improvement to my daily use. I'm not someone who games on mobile or worries about specs much, so I'm not the right person to ask about those types of things. The new changes that I do notice are either minor or too niche to move the needle much. With all that said, I don't have any complaints about the phone and do find it to be a small upgrade over the S23 Ultra. As a bit of a tech rube, I'm sure this phone is better than I have expressed.
I bought S26 Ultra 512GB. I faced issue with the screen. It was very spontaneous, for a fraction of second and the disappear, that's why I couldn't take screenshot or make video, but I am adding an image downloaded from internet to show you how I appeared to me. I kept the phone for around a month and I faced this issue 4, 5 time when I tried to open an application, or an image from the gallery or anytime when screen was switching from one to another. Other than that, it was a bit slow in performance, which I wasn't expecting from a brand new flagship phone. I am a fan of Galaxy Phones Ultra, so I assume that my device was faulty. Anyway, I returned that device and asked for a replacement with another device of same Model. Thanks,

[This review was collected as part of a promotion.] This phone works excellent was a great upgrade from my s24 ultra, the battery is a lot better, the display is amazing especially the privacy display and I don't need the glass that ruins the display quality anymore. The Galaxy Ai features are great they are similar to the s24 ultra but it has a few great upgrades that I use almost daily, it's overall an amazing device and worth the upgrade.

[This review was collected as part of a promotion.] The S26 Ultra has exceeded my expectations. It's faster and more powerful than previous Galaxy S devices, and the latest Galaxy AI makes using the S26 for a variety of tasks so easy!
The camera and editing tools are amazing, and the S Pen works even better than others I've used, despite the fact that I was concerned that its corner location might be inconvenient. The rounded corners and flat screen are a big improvement over previous versions of this phone, which had square corners and a beveled screen.
I'm sure there are tons of new features that will take months to discover, but I've been enjoying every minute since I got the phone.
